Job Opportunities

The SigEp Headquarters staff is a dedicated team of professionals committed to the growth and success of our Fraternity. If you are interested in becoming a member of our team, please consider the job opportunities below.

Our Mission:

We provide an infrastructure for services, resources and experiences that allow our members — undergraduates, alumni and volunteers — to build balanced leaders, create lifelong relationships, and prepare for life in and after college. 

Our Values:

Our core values are what we believe about our staff. They are how we do our work to achieve our mission. They are what we can hold ourselves and each other accountable to. They build continuity for our culture.

  • Put people first.
  • Lead with courage.
  • Focus on future.
  • Seek to improve.
  • Win as a team.

Our Culture:

Our staff is made up of more than 50 talented, motivated, adaptable individuals. As a staff that services 350,000 lifetime members, our work is dynamic and flexible to the needs of the day, while still requiring alignment with our future-focused strategic plan to accomplish growth in our impact. As such, our culture can be proudly described as a “startup” culture. We are deeply motivated by our mission, adaptable to the challenges of the day and proud of our ability to spread our impact more and more each year.  

What’s in it for you? 

  • Impact: Simply put, when our staff does well, we create a profound impact on the experiences of college students across the country. Our members have more opportunities for growth and lifelong relationships because of our work. Your work matters. That sense of fulfillment can be felt both directly from interactions with members and from a strategic level when we achieve our organizational goals. 
  • Ownership: Between long-term projects, daily needs and new challenges, the work we do requires our staff to take initiative to drive toward organizational success. While there is always support to help you cross the finish line when you need it, your work is yours to own. You have the autonomy to set a vision, engage key collaborators and take a project or task from start to finish.
  • Growth: We are committed to personal and professional development. While each role is different and has its own set of unique responsibilities, our organization provides opportunities for a flexible and dynamic work environment that meets the needs of the individual while also providing opportunities for supported growth through mentoring, challenging projects and structured professional development.
